Windiest Greek Islands for Luxury Yacht Charters
The solid summertime winds called Meltemi (also called Etesian wind) can be a challenge for luxury yacht charters. However they are additionally a natural cooling device, offering remedy for the hot summertime heat, minimizing moisture and improving presence.
The Meltemi is toughest in the Cyclades, specifically on the western islands of Tinos, Andros and Paros. Mainland Greece and the Saronic Islands are usually less affected.

The meltemi winds are greatest on the islands during July and August. These strong katabatic winds are brought on by distinctions in air pressure over the Aegean Sea and can reach force 7-8 on the Beaufort range.
These effective winds may affect ferryboat routines and regional boat trips. They can even create some seaside erosion and damages to property on the islands.
